Leadership in college government presents unique challenges and opportunities to serve with integrity and impact peers positively. As a student leader, you stand at a crossroads where decisions can shape not only your campus but your character. Biblical leadership is defined not by power or popularity but by servanthood, humility, and truth. This study invites you to anchor your leadership journey in Scripture, cultivating qualities that honor God and foster trust among your peers.
Throughout these seven days, we will explore key passages and principles that equip you to lead with wisdom and grace. You'll discover how biblical leaders modeled courage in standing for truth, the importance of humility in influence, and the ways servant leadership transforms communities. Whether you're elected to represent, advocate, or organize, embracing these truths empowers you to serve well and leave a legacy beyond your college years.
Each day, take time to reflect deeply, journal your thoughts, and pray for God's guidance. This isnโt just about strategy or success but about becoming the kind of leader who mirrors Christโs example โ one who leads by serving, uplifts others, and honors God in all decisions.
